Cairo – Mubasher: Egypt and Saudi Arabia have signed 17 cooperation agreements on the sidelines of King Salman's official visit to Cairo.
The signing ceremony was witnessed by President Abdel Fattah El-Sisi and King Salman at El-Ettihadiah presidential palace.
Ministers from both countries singed memorandums of understanding in the fields of trade, industry, housing, nuclear power, education, security and media.
King Salman also unveiled a plan to build a bridge linking the two countries.
This is the King's first official visit to Egypt since he came to the throne in 2015.
